- ************************** CHANGES ******************************************
- ;
- ; version 2.1.6
- ;
- ; - fixed a bug when "growing" memory. It was using the return value when
- ; the function was not supposed to be returning anything valid.
- ;
- ; - added a version string so "version prodraw.import" will report the
- ; version of the module.
- ;
- ; - fixed a bug that would cause PgS to crash when the object was pasted.
- ; (the o_end call was never made to match the o_begingroup call)
- ;
- ; - changed the way the various implementaions of the PDRF chunk length
- ; is handle - it is now ignored. The module uses the length of the
- ; file instead.
- ;
- ; - added "clean up" code the pget? calls for d0
- ;
- ;
- ; version 2.1.5 (uploaded 4/19/91)
- ;
- ; - fixed bug when importing compound object. the default object defs
- ; were getting set each time a new part of the compound obj came in.
- ; this means object data such as line color and width were being set to
- ; the defaults instead of the actual values wanted.
- ;
- ; - added support for rounded ends on lines
- ;
- ;
- ; version 2.1.4 (uploaded 3/29/91 ?)
- ;
- ; - syndesis files are now imported. they were writing their files a
- ; little differently than ProDraw. they did not include a COLR "chunk"
- ; at the start of each color - only the color section. also the PDPF
- ; length did not include the entire file as prodraw does - it was 4
- ; bytes short. (it did not include the PDPF tag).
- ;
- ; - bug fix: sometimes a clip would exit without getting to the paste
- ; cursor, this was due to a routine corrupting the counting register
- ; used to skip extra data not needed. This has been fixed.
- ;
- ; - changed the way compound objects are delt with, this fixed several
- ; problems with them.
- ;
- ; - bug fix: if a circle object started a compound object it was not
- ; detected and problems would result. This has been fixed.
- ;
- ; - objects are now better aligned with other objects.
- ;
- ; - filled open polygons are now supported.
- ;
- ; - rotated circles are placed correctly now.
- ;
- ;
- ; version 2.1.3 (shipped with PgS2.1 12/7/90)
- ;
- ; - bug fixes: when importing older clips
- ;
- ; - misc bugs when importing a bitmap traced object
- ; (not completly fixed yet)
- ;
- ;
- ; version 2.1.2 (uploaded 11/15/90 ?)
- ;
- ; - added support for compound objects (holes&cutouts now supported)
- ;
- ; - circles are now converted into 4 bezier curves
- ;
- ;
- ; version 2.1.1 (uploaded 11/2/90)
- ;
- ; - the size is closer to the size in prodraw
- ;
- ;
- ; version 2.1.0 (uploaded w/ pagestream2.1.3)
- ;
- ; - initial release
